Considering how often we use our hands on a daily basis, it makes sense that the moment they get rough, dry, or cracked, we feel uncomfortable, if not a bit self-conscious. When the skin barrier is breached, moisture loss and unprotected exposure to the environment result. This is when rough hands occur. This is more likely to occur in dry, cold weather, when you wash your hands more regularly, or when you are working with abrasive materials. Do not be alarmed. Rough hands are a result of a combination of habitual personal habits like overwashing and inadequate moisturizing, as well as environmental factors like dry air from heating systems or chilly, gusty winds.
